Kohler Co. Senior Systems Analyst, Procurement Operations in Kohler, Wisconsin

Senior Systems Analyst, Procurement Operations

Work Mode: Hybrid

Location: Hybrid at Kohler, WI

Opportunity (https://kohler.csod.com/ATS/JobRequisition/JobRequisition.aspx?new=1&rrid=5446&rrtid=28#)

This position is responsible for supporting a variety of Global Procurement systems including Kohler’s Supplier Management Platform (powered by Jaggaer), SAP, PowerBI, and any other related data collection/reporting systems. Additional responsibilities include organization and management of Procurement SharePoint sites, ServiceNow, systems monitoring of adherence to global policies within procurement systems, system performance reporting, issue diagnosis and resolution, supporting continuous improvement initiatives, system user training, and other projects. Strong communication skills will be essential, as will having the ability to work alone or part of a team.

Specific Responsibilities

  • Responsible for procurement systems user training, system issue diagnosis and resolution for all Kohler businesses. This will require proactive learning and subject matter expertise in multiple procurement tools.

  • Responsible for identifying process & systems improvement solutions for the purchasing function, integrating global best practices & streamlining processes.

  • Work collaboratively with project leads within the team, IT, procurement analysts, buyers, other business stakeholders, and management on specific projects and new technology implementations as needed.

  • Lead other ad hoc projects on a local, regional or global basis in a timely and professional manner.

  • Some travel may be required from time to time as needed for training or projects.

  • Flexible to working with counterparts in various time zones especially China during their work hours when needed

Skills/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Business, Information Technology, Supply Chain, Procurement orrelated field, or the combination of education, training and/or experience preferred.

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ills to professionally address a wide andvaried audience.

  • Strong computer skills, including Microsoft Office products required.

  • Good command of both written and spoken English is required.

  • Organizational and time management skills sufficient to handle multiple priorities in afast paced and ever-changing environment required.

  • Intermediate knowledge of SAP and master data management experience preferred.

  • Familiarity with the use of PowerBI preferred.

  • HTML and web design skills are nice to have.

  • Some travel required (less than 10%).

  • Some work hour adjustments might be needed to support collaborative teamwork withmultiple regions.

  • Hybrid in Kohler, WI - 3 days per week

Applicants must be authorized to work in the US without requiring sponsorship now or in the future.

The salary range for this position is $73,400 - $92,500. The specific salary offered to a candidate may be influenced by a variety of factors including the candidate’s experience, their education, and the work location. Available benefits include medical, dental, vision & 401k.
